Block 4 · Irons

Nine clubs that must agree with each other

A driver only has to work on its own. An iron set has to be internally consistent, and that is a completely different specification problem.

The set problem

Matching matters more than any single number

Golfers arrive asking which iron head they should buy. It is almost never the question that matters. What matters is whether the nine clubs in the bag are consistent with one another: even length steps, a smooth frequency progression, swingweights inside a point of each other, and lofts spaced so that each club has a job nothing else is doing.

Sets fail that test constantly, and not only cheap ones. Manufacturing tolerance on lofts and lies is wider than most golfers imagine, and a set can leave a factory with two clubs a degree and a half apart from their stamps. Add a few seasons of practice-mat contact, which quietly bends lies flatter over time, and the ladder that looked orderly on the shelf has holes in it.

Most iron complaints are set-consistency problems wearing a head-model costume.

So the iron block on our sheet is arranged by club rather than by category. Every iron gets its own row: length, loft, lie, frequency, swingweight, and the carry number it produced. Reading down a column is how a gap becomes obvious.

Lie angle

Read off tape, not off a chart

Static charts convert height and wrist-to-floor into a lie recommendation. They are a useful place to begin testing and a poor place to finish, because lie is about how you deliver the sole at impact, not how you stand at address.

We put tape on the sole and a board under the ball, and read the mark. Two golfers who measure identically on a chart routinely need lies three or four degrees apart, because one of them drops the hands at impact and the other does not.

The consequence of getting it wrong is directional and it compounds with loft. A short iron two degrees upright will start noticeably left of target for a right-handed golfer; the same error in a 5-iron shows up much less. That is why the sheet lists lie per club and why we bend to a progression rather than to one figure for the whole set.

The ladder

Distances that step evenly

Every carry figure on the sheet is measured over a run of strikes and recorded with the sample size beside it. A number derived from one well-struck shot is not a yardage, it is an anecdote.

Sample iron block from a full bag document
ClubLengthLoftLieCarryStep
5 iron37.75 in25.0°61.0°168 yd
6 iron37.25 in28.5°61.5°157 yd11
7 iron36.75 in32.0°62.0°146 yd11
8 iron36.25 in36.0°62.5°134 yd12
9 iron35.75 in40.5°63.0°122 yd12
PW35.50 in45.0°63.5°110 yd12

Even steps are the goal, and an eleven-yard gap beside a nineteen-yard gap is the defect we look for. Where a set cannot be bent into an even ladder, the answer is usually a change of set composition rather than a change of brand.

Length progression

Half-inch steps are conventional, but a golfer who strikes long irons poorly and short irons well is often better served by a shortened long-iron end. The step size goes on the sheet because a replacement club built years later needs to know it.

Shaft weight

Steel from 85 to 130 grams and graphite from 55 to 95 sits on the rack. Weight is chosen before flex and matters more, particularly for golfers past sixty and anyone with a wrist or elbow history.

Set composition

Not everyone should carry a 4-iron. Replacing the top of a set with hybrids, or blending two head models across the set, is a written decision on the sheet rather than an afterthought at the till.
